Mankind Pharma has announced a strategic collaboration with Denovo Sciences to strengthen its drug discovery capabilities through artificial intelligence (AI), marking a significant step toward technology-enabled pharmaceutical research. The partnership aims to accelerate the identification of promising drug candidates while reducing the time and cost associated with early-stage drug development.
Under the collaboration, Mankind Pharma will combine its research and development expertise, clinical development capabilities, and experimental validation infrastructure with Denovo Sciences' proprietary AI-powered molecular generation and prioritization platform. The integrated approach is expected to improve the quality of lead candidates and enable researchers to identify high-potential molecules more efficiently.
A key feature of the collaboration is the adoption of a human-in-the-loop model, where artificial intelligence generates and evaluates potential molecular candidates while experienced scientists validate, refine, and guide the decision-making process. This hybrid approach is designed to maintain scientific rigor while leveraging AI to explore a broader range of molecular possibilities.
According to Mankind Pharma, the initiative focuses on three primary objectives: reducing early drug discovery timelines, enhancing the quality of lead compounds, and ensuring that only the most promising candidates advance into further development. By applying computational precision during the initial stages of research, both organizations aim to minimize resources spent on molecules with lower chances of success.
